Why Create a Facebook Page?
Before diving into the creation process, let's understand the benefits:
- Increased Brand Awareness: A Facebook Page allows you to showcase your brand, products, or services to a vast potential customer base.
- Direct Customer Engagement: Interact directly with your audience, answer questions, and build a loyal following.
- Targeted Advertising: Facebook's powerful advertising platform enables you to reach specific demographics and interests with your marketing messages.
- Cost-Effective Marketing: Compared to traditional marketing, Facebook offers affordable ways to reach thousands of potential customers.
- Improved Customer Service: Provide quick and convenient support directly through your Facebook Page.
- Build Community: Foster a sense of community around your brand by sharing updates, engaging with posts, and running contests.
Step-by-Step Guide to Creating Your Facebook Page:
Step 1: Log into Facebook
First, you need to log in to your personal Facebook account. You'll need an account to create a Page.
Step 2: Navigate to Page Creation
Once logged in, look for the "Create" button, usually located in the top right corner of the screen. Click on it and select "Page."
Step 3: Choose a Page Category
Facebook offers various categories for Pages. Select the category that best represents your business, brand, or organization. Choosing the right category is crucial for proper categorization and visibility. Be as specific as possible. For example, instead of just "Business," choose a more precise category like "Restaurant" or "Clothing Store."
Step 4: Provide Page Information
This is where you'll provide the essential details for your Facebook Page:
- Page Name: Choose a name that's memorable, relevant, and accurately reflects your brand.
- Category: (This was already chosen in Step 3, but you may want to double-check)
- Profile Picture: Use a high-quality image that clearly represents your brand or organization. Think of this as your Page's logo. Aim for a professional, eye-catching image.
- Cover Photo: This larger image provides a visual representation of your Page. Make it appealing and reflect your brand's aesthetic.
Step 5: Add a Brief Description
Write a concise and compelling description that highlights what your Page is about. Keep it brief, engaging, and informative. This helps users quickly understand what your page offers.
Step 6: Complete Your Page Setup
Once you've completed the previous steps, you can add additional information such as:
- Contact Information: This is critical for customer interaction. Include your website, email address, phone number, and physical address (if applicable).
- Business Hours: Specify your operating hours to manage customer expectations.
- Location: Add your business address to help people find your physical location if you have one.
